CP1 Planar Nuclear Medicine Imaging - Musculoskeletal System ICD-10-PCS
The CP1 code range contains 26 ICD-10-PCS codes for Planar Nuclear Medicine Imaging procedures on the musculoskeletal system. 25 of the codes are billable and valid for inpatient claim submission in fiscal year 2026.
Root Operation Definition
Planar Nuclear Medicine Imaging: Introduction of radioactive materials into the body for single plane display of images developed from the capture of radioactive emissions.

About the CP1 Code Range
The ICD-10-PCS root operation Planar Nuclear Medicine Imaging (code prefix CP1) refers to a diagnostic procedure using radionuclide tracers to create two-dimensional images of the Musculoskeletal System. This technique helps visualize bone and joint function through planar imaging captures.
Within the Nuclear Medicine classification, these codes specify the body part imaged and the radionuclide used, such as Technetium 99m (Tc-99m) or other radionuclides. Examples include planar imaging of the Skull (codes CP111ZZ, CP11YZZ), Thorax (CP141ZZ, CP14YZZ), and Spine (CP151ZZ, CP15YZZ). Codes also cover upper and lower extremities, pelvis, or multiple combined sites like the Spine and Pelvis. The variety of codes allows precise documentation of the imaging procedure performed and the tracer used, which is essential for accurate diagnosis and billing in nuclear medicine involving musculoskeletal evaluations.
